How to Draw Mountains on Your Fantasy Map — Map Effects | Fantasy map, Mountain drawing, Fantasy map drawing ideas

Mountains are perhaps the most important natural feature you can draw on a map. They impact weather patterns, where rivers flow, and ultimately where cities and nations arise. How to Draw Coastlines on a Fantasy Map - Fantastic Maps

I’ve realised I have a particular workflow for drawing coastlines in my maps. Here’s a quick walkthrough. Each step is done on a new layer in photoshop, and I use a 5px hard round brush in each case with size set to pressure. 4 Coast Styles for Mapmaking - Fantastic Maps

There are lots of ways to indicate water on a map with lines – and many more with tone or colour. Here are four I regularly use. 1. Broken Waves After you have your coastline, use short, gently curving lines along the shore.
